So I was looking for a safety flag to mount on the new Zoom transom and ran across these flag / strobe light combos. The lights are available in red or white and can be set to a constant on mode. I was thinking this could serve double duty (white LED) as the stern nav light since the 1 watt LED should be visible at 360 degrees for at least a mile. Good idea?
